How is the City of London incentivizing bike and ped commuters for helping improve the air? There's an App for that.
London is working with a company called Recyclebank that devised their own App to rewards recyclers with points they can use just like an airline or credit card loyalty system.
Ariel Schwarz reports:
"The mobile phone app allows London-based users to log the distance of their journeys and receive points depending on the length. At the end of each journey, Recyclebank will reveal the number of points earned as well as health and environmental benefits (number of trees saved, miles saved by staying off the road, carbon emissions). The app can also show users nearby locations where they can redeem their points."
